§ 1701.
National Recording Registry of the Library of Congress

The Librarian of Congress shall establish the National Recording Registry for the purpose of maintaining and preserving sound recordings that are culturally, historically, or aesthetically significant.

(Pub. L. 106–474, title I, § 101, Nov. 9, 2000, 114 Stat. 2085.)
